<h3>What is acetaminophen suppository used for?</h3>
This medication is used to treat mild to moderate pain, such as cramps, menstrual periods, toothaches, aching joints, osteoarthritis, and cold/flu aches and pains, as well as to lower fever.
Acetaminophen rectal is being used to treat mild to moderate pain caused by headaches or muscle aches, as well as to reduce fever.
Acetaminophen belongs to the analgesics which are pain relievers and antipyretics class of medications are fever reducers.
